A.P. Moller-Maersk (OTCMKTS:AMKBY - Get Free Report) was upgraded by equities research analysts at Wolfe Research from a "strong sell" rating to a "hold" rating in a note issued to investors on Tuesday, Zacks reports.
Several other research firms have also recently issued reports on AMKBY. The Goldman Sachs Group upgraded shares of A.P. Moller-Maersk from a "sell"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note on Friday, July 3rd. Nordea Equity Research upgraded shares of A.P. Moller-Maersk from a "sell"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note on Friday, August 14th. Morgan Stanley reissued an "underweight" rating on shares of A.P. Moller-Maersk in a report on Friday. Fearnley Fonds upgraded shares of A.P. Moller-Maersk from a "strong sell" rating to a "hold" rating in a research report on Thursday, June 11th. Finally, Citigroup restated a "neutral" rating on shares of A.P. Moller-Maersk in a report on Monday, August 17th. One research analyst has r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, eight have issued a Hold rating and four have given a Sell rating to the st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the company presently has a consensus rating of "Reduce".

A.P. Moller-Maersk Stock Performance
Shares of AMKBY opened at $17.21 on Tuesday. The business's fifty day simple moving average is $14.25 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$13.06. The company has a current ratio of 1.98, a quick ratio of 1.85 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.09. A.P. Moller-Maersk has a 12 month low of $9.23 and a 12 month high of $17.70. The company has a market cap of $54.48 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 22.06 and a beta of 0.73.
A.P. Moller-Maersk (OTCMKTS:AMKBY -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, August 13th. The transportation company reported $0.45 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.14 by $0.31. The firm had revenue of $15.76 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$14.07 billion. A.P. Moller-Maersk had a return on equity of 4.38% and a net margin of 4.08%. Research analysts anticipate that A.P. Moller-Maersk will post 2.2 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

A.P. Moller-Maersk A/S is a Danish integrated logistics and transportation company that provides services across global supply chains. Its activities include container shipping, port and terminal operations, logistics, freight forwarding, customs services, warehousing and distribution. Through its ocean business, Maersk transports manufactured goods, commodities and other cargo between major markets worldwide.
The company also provides end-to-end supply chain solutions, including air and ocean freight, inland transportation, contract logistics and digital supply chain management services.
